SMPP (Short Message Peer-to-Peer)

Short Message Peer-to-Peer is the IETF/SMS-Forum protocol used between SMSCs, ESMEs, and aggregators to submit and deliver SMS messages over IP. SMPP carries A2P traffic that includes one-time passwords, marketing, and notifications, and is the principal interface used by enterprise SMS platforms. Weak authentication, plaintext transport, and lax binding controls have enabled high-profile abuse such as SMS spoofing and OTP interception, so TLS, IP allow-listing, and aggregator due diligence are essential.
